Sao Joao Del Rei (JDR) to Recife (REC) Flight Distance
The flight distance from Prefeito Octavio de Almeida Neves Airport (JDR) in Sao Joao Del Rei, Brazil to Guararapes - Gilberto Freyre International Airport (REC) in Recife, Brazil is 1,753 kilometers (1,089 miles / 947 nautical miles). The estimated flight time for this route is approximately 3h, flying northeast at a heading of 36°.
